Some tips for cutting water waste
Did you know that

the average person
without
a washing machine
at home still uses
more than 45 gallons
of water a day?
In fact that’s a conservative
estimate!
At LeFrak City,
which more than
14,000 people call
home, household water
usage totals nearly 650,000
gallons every day, adding up to nearly
24 million gallons a year.
More than a third of an average
household’s water usage comes simply
from fl ushing your toilet. Reports
show that 37% of water consumed in
a given day comes from toilets, while
24% comes from showers and baths,
22% from sinks and 17% from leaks.
With so many of us concerned
about our environment, taking a few
easy steps toward conserving water at
home will help protect our world for
years to come.
Here are some tips that you can follow
to conserve water:
• Report a leak! A leaky faucet
or toilet may not seem like a big
deal, but leaks account for an estimated
17% of household water
usage. Th at’s a lot of wasted water,
so please contact Management immediately
if you spot a leak in your
apartment.
• Shower, don’t bathe! It takes about
70 gallons of water to fi ll the standard
bathtub. Using
a standard showerhead,
a fiveminute
shower
uses just 25
gallons of
water. If you
do want to
treat yourself
to a bath,
please close
the drain before
turning on the water,
and only fi ll your
tub halfway.
• Shorten your shower! Every minute
you shorten your shower saves
up to 75 gallons of water per month.
If every LeFrak City resident were
to cut their showers by one minute
each, more than 1,000,000 gallons
of water would be conserved each
month. It makes a huge diff erence!
• Turn off the tap! Most people leave
the bathroom sink faucet running
while they wash their face, brush
their teeth or shave. Turning off
the tap, however, can save 70 gallons
of water or more per month.
One simple way to save water is to
brush your teeth while waiting for
the water to get hot, then to wash
or shave once the basin is fi lled.
• Don’t flush if you don’t have
to! Rather than throwing tissues
or other light waste in the toilet,
throw it in the trashcan.
• Get a handle on it! If your toilet
handle sticks frequently, your toilet
could be running and wasting water
long aft er you’ve fl ushed. Have
the sticks replaced or adjusted to
slow the fl ow back to normal.
• Fill the sink! If you wash your
dishes by hand, please fi ll the sink
rather than letting the faucet run.
Doing this will save between 8 and
15 gallons of water daily.
• Store your water. Keep a pitcher of
drinking water in the refrigerator
instead of turning on the tap and
letting it run until the water gets
cold.
• Reuse your water! Th ere’s no reason
to pour unused clean water
down the drain. Use it instead to
clean your home or water a houseplant.
Around the grounds
» You can also help LeFrak City
conserve water by keeping a
careful eye out for waste around
the grounds.
» If you believe a washing machine
is inefficient, or if you think
it is leaking, please inform
Management right away.
» When lawns are being watered
during the summer, make a
mental note of the time of day
you see the sprinklers on. Lawns
are best watered while the sun
is down to reduce evaporation.
Report to Management any
instance in which you see the
sprinklers running during the
middle of the day.
» Also let Management know if you
see someone using water to clean
walkways instead of sweeping
them, or if you spot broken
sprinklers or leaky or broken
pipes.
